Testing y Validación de Base de Datos
Validamos la integridad, seguridad y rendimiento de la base de datos mediante pruebas especializadas que permiten detectar errores, inconsistencias y problemas de desempeño antes de que afecten al sistema en producción.
Analizamos consultas, estructuras, relaciones y procesos para garantizar que la información sea confiable, segura y eficiente.
¿En qué consiste el testing de base de datos?
El testing de base de datos consiste en verificar que la información almacenada en el sistema sea correcta, consistente y segura, validando que las consultas, procedimientos y estructuras funcionen de manera adecuada.
Este tipo de pruebas permite detectar errores que pueden afectar el funcionamiento del sistema, el rendimiento o la integridad de los datos.
Problemas que podemos identificar
Lista:
- Datos inconsistentes
- Consultas lentas
- Errores en procedimientos almacenados
- Problemas de integridad
- Relaciones incorrectas
- Falta de índices
- Bloqueos en la base de datos
- Problemas de concurrencia
- Pérdida de datos
- Fallos en transacciones
Texto opcional:
Estos problemas pueden generar errores en el sistema, lentitud o pérdida de información.
Aspectos que analizamos
Lista:
- Integridad de datos
- Relaciones entre tablas
- Índices
- Consultas SQL
- Procedimientos almacenados
- Triggers
- Transacciones
- Seguridad
- Permisos
- Rendimiento
Texto:
Se revisan todos los componentes que pueden afectar la confiabilidad de la base de datos.
Tipos de pruebas que realizamos
Tipos de pruebas que realizamos
Pruebas de rendimiento
Evaluación de consultas y tiempos de respuesta.
Pruebas de seguridad
Revisión de accesos y permisos.
Pruebas de concurrencia
Validación de múltiples usuarios.
Pruebas de transacciones
Control de operaciones críticas.
Pruebas de migración
Validación de cambios de base de datos.
Herramientas que utilizamos
- SQL Server tools
- PostgreSQL tools
- MySQL tools
- pgAdmin
- DBeaver
- Oracle tools
- Query Analyzer
- Performance Monitor
- Grafana
- Scripts SQL
Texto:
Seleccionamos la herramienta según el tipo de base de datos.
Metodología de pruebas
Lista numerada:
- Análisis de la base de datos
- Definición de pruebas
- Ejecución de consultas
- Validación de resultados
- Pruebas de rendimiento
- Revisión de seguridad
- Informe técnico
- Recomendaciones
Beneficios del testing de base de datos
Lista:
- Evitar pérdida de datos
- Mejor rendimiento
- Mayor seguridad
- Datos confiables
- Menos errores en el sistema
- Mejor estabilidad
- Mejor mantenimiento
A quién va dirigido
Lista:
- Empresas de software
- Sistemas empresariales
- Instituciones públicas
- Sistemas críticos
- Sistemas con mucha información
- Aplicaciones web
- Aplicaciones móviles
Solicite una revisión de su base de datos
Podemos evaluar la integridad, seguridad y rendimiento de su información.

